Fornoff Electric was founded in 1968 by Bob Fornoff, serving the Conejo and San Fernando valleys with expert electrical installations and repairs. In 1993, his son Mark took over the business and became president of the company.From age 10, Mark accompanied his father on jobs and, over a period of more than 20 years, Mark learned firsthand all aspects of the business-from system design to installation to marketing. With a mix of historic homes, modern builds, and increasing demand for energy-efficient upgrades, electrical work in Thousand Oaks requires a unique blend of expertise and local knowledge. Whether you live in a mid-century home in the Wildwood neighborhood with aging knob-and-tube wiring or a newer property in Lang Ranch preparing for an EV charger installation, you need a licensed electrician who understands the specific challenges of our area.
One common issue we encounter in Thousand Oaks is the need for service panel upgrades, especially as homeowners integrate solar systems or add high-powered appliances. Panel upgrades here typically range from $2,500 to $5,000, depending on the size and complexity. Another frequent request is installing recessed lighting, which can cost $200 to $400 per fixture depending on ceiling access. Navigating local regulations, including AFCI/GFCI compliance and Title 24 energy standards, is critical to ensuring your project passes inspection with the City of Thousand Oaks Building and Safety Division.
Whether it’s trenching permits for underground conduit, rewiring older homes, or meeting today’s energy codes, electrical work in Thousand Oaks demands precision and experience. The National Electrical Code (NEC) is a set of standards designed to ensure electrical systems are safe and functional. It’s updated every three years and governs residential, commercial, and industrial wiring practices. Adhering to the NEC helps:
Licensed electricians are required to follow NEC guidelines when performing installations or repairs. You can find more about it on the National Fire Protection Association's NEC page.
